摘要
An improved route is provided for producing seeds capable of forming aBrassica napus F1 hybrid via plant breeding wherein the vegetable oil of theseeds exhibits a highly elevated oleic acid (C18:1) content of at least 80percent by weight (e.g. 80 to 86 percent by weight) and a reduced linolenicacid (C18:3) content of no more than 3 percent by weight (e.g. 1 to 3 percentby weight) based upon the total fatty acid content. The female parent plant(i.e., the seed parent) possesses a homozygous modified FAD-2 gene pair forelevated oleic acid production solely in either the A-genome or the C-genome,and the male parent (i.e., the pollen parent) possesses a homozygous modifiedFAD-2 gene pair for highly elevated oleic acid production in both the A-genomeand the C-genome. Both parent plants also include at least one homozygousmodified FAD-3 gene pair for reduced linolenic acid production. Anendogenously formed Brassica napus oil is provided that is particularly wellsuited for use in frying application. Such oil exhibits further stability inview of the low concentration of linolenic acid that concomitantly is producedwithin the seeds.
